“Pending” means a unit is booked in for refurbishment but not yet graded and ready. If nothing above fits, it’s worth asking anyway — pending units often clear within a week or two, and we’ll flag you when your size and grade comes up.

Why refurbished is worth a look right now

Cost is the obvious draw, but there are two other reasons it’s worth considering alongside a new purchase. First, availability: a graded refurbished unit is often ready to ship straight away, without waiting on a new-build lead time. Second, it keeps a perfectly capable machine in service rather than heading for scrap — something more customers are asking us about as sustainability becomes part of the buying decision, not an afterthought.

Every unit is graded Gold, Silver or Bronze against condition and remaining ink capacity, so you know exactly what you’re getting before you commit — we’ve covered the full grading system in an earlier post if you want the detail. This week’s list skews heavily Gold, which is the grade most customers ask for first.
